The Parliament Defends Before the TC that the Repeal of the Memory Law Does Not Protect the Victims

Summary by Forbes España
PALMA, 9 (EUROPA PRESS) The Parliament has asked the Constitutional Court (TC) to lift the suspension of the repeal of the law of democratic memory by considering that there are no damages resulting from that decision and insisting that the victims are not being protected and that exhumations have not been paralysed.In a recent statement of allegations signed by the Chamber's senior official counsel, the institution rejects the maintenance of th…
